How the result moves

Multiply each value by its weight, add the two products, divide by the weights added together. A score of 80 weighted 3 and a score of 90 weighted 1 give 330 ÷ 4 = 82.5. Only the ratio of the weights matters: 3 and 1 give the same answer as 30 and 10.

How it's calculated

Weighted average = (v₁ × w₁ + v₂ × w₂) ÷ (w₁ + w₂)

Questions

How do I calculate a weighted average?

Multiply each value by its weight, add the products, and divide by the total weight: (v₁ × w₁ + v₂ × w₂) ÷ (w₁ + w₂). A score of 80 weighted 3 and a score of 90 weighted 1 give (240 + 90) ÷ 4 = 82.5.

What is a weighted average?

It is an average where each value counts according to its weight rather than equally. Values with a larger weight pull the result toward themselves, which is why a final exam worth three times a quiz dominates the overall grade.

How is it different from a normal average?

A normal average treats every value equally, a weighted average lets some count more. When the weights are equal the two are identical — 60 and 80 with weights 5 and 5 give 70, exactly the plain average. The difference only appears once the weights differ.

What numbers should I use for the weights?

Any non-negative numbers that reflect how much each value should count: percentages such as 60 and 40, credit hours, or plain multipliers like 3 and 1. Only the ratio between them matters, so 3 and 1 give the same answer as 30 and 10.

How do I use this for grades?

Enter each grade as a value and its course weighting as the weight. If the exam is worth 70 percent and coursework 30, put the exam grade with weight 70 and the coursework grade with weight 30. The result is the overall weighted grade.

Can the weights be zero?

A single weight can be zero, which simply drops that value: 12.5 weighted 2 against 7.5 weighted 0 returns 12.5. If both weights are zero there is nothing left to weight, and the calculator falls back to the plain average of the two values.
